update harfbuzz to upstream release 1.0.3

RESOLVED FIXED in Firefox 43

Status

()

defect
RESOLVED FIXED
4 years ago
3 years ago

People

(Reporter: ionnv, Assigned: jfkthame)

Tracking

unspecified
mozilla43
Points:
---
Dependency tree / graph

Firefox Tracking Flags

(firefox43 fixed)

Details

(Whiteboard: [gfx-noted], )

Attachments

(1 attachment)

http://cgit.freedesktop.org/harfbuzz/commit/?id=789b89ef7130ffe5f22c571fc3cb4e6d35456654

Overview of changes leading to 1.0.2
Wednesday, August 19, 2015
====================================

- Fix shaping with cluster-level > 0.
- Fix Uniscribe backend font-size scaling.
- Declare dependencies in harfbuzz.pc.
  FreeType is not declared though, to avoid bugs in pkg-config
  0.26 with recursive dependencies.
- Slightly improved debug infrastructure.  More to come later.
- Misc build fixes.
Depends on: 1146151
Whiteboard: [gfx-noted]
Release 1.0.3 is out, and has some significant fixes to the finer-grained clustering support that we used for bug 729993, so we should take this update.
Status: UNCONFIRMED → NEW
Ever confirmed: true
Summary: update harfbuzz to upstream release 1.0.2 → update harfbuzz to upstream release 1.0.3
Assignee: nobody → jfkthame
Status: NEW → ASSIGNED
Attachment #8655938 - Flags: review?(jdaggett) → review+
https://hg.mozilla.org/mozilla-central/rev/0dd0065b4a20
Status: ASSIGNED → RESOLVED
Closed: 4 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la43
You need to log in before you can comment on or make changes to this bug.